Is the hawke vantage 2 3-7x a decent scope? by fairplanet in airguns

[–]dgod40 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Parallax is when your reticle, the crosshair, is not in the same focal plane. What that usually means is that when you look through your scope you can see the crosshair clearly but the object is blurry. But it also means that when you move your head just a little without moving the scope the reticle moves around which will cause point of impact issues. This is usually an issue more for longer distances but the blurryness is more of an issue for airgun distances. My air rifle came with a fixed parallax at 50m. I shoot more often at 25m. The objects were blurry. Got the Hawke and now I can adjust all the way down to10yards and have a blur free shot.
